Hey friend,

As we close this month together, I want to leave you with this truth:

Help is holy because people matter to God.

Not just productive people.
Not just strong people.
Not just healed people.

People.

Tired people. Hopeful people. Grieving people. Waiting people. Caregivers. Leaders. Parents. Friends. Quiet people carrying invisible burdens. People trying to hold on while life feels uncertain.

God cares deeply about people.

That is why support matters.
That is why kindness matters.
That is why encouragement matters.
That is why showing up matters.

And honestly, I think one of the enemy’s greatest strategies is convincing people they are alone, unseen, unsupported, or unworthy of care.

But isolation is not God’s heart for us.

Again and again, scripture points us back toward community, compassion, encouragement, generosity, prayer, presence, and love in action. God designed us to strengthen one another while we walk through life together.

Which means this month was never only about needing help.

It was also about becoming the kind of person who helps carry hope for others too.

The friend who checks in.
The person who notices.
The encourager.
The safe space.
The prayer warrior.
The calm voice.
The steady presence.

Friend, do not underestimate how powerful simple support can be in a hurting world.

A lot of people are still standing because somebody loved them consistently through a hard season.

And maybe part of your purpose is helping somebody else keep standing too.

Help is holy because people matter to God.

And so do you.
